Physical Activity and Survival After Prostate Cancer
Abstract
Despite the high global prevalence of prostate cancer (PCa), few epidemiologic studies have assessed physical activity in relation to PCa survival.To evaluate different types, intensities, and timing of physical activity relative to PCa survival.A prospective study was conducted in Alberta, Canada, in a cohort of 830 stage II-IV incident PCa cases diagnosed between 1997 and 2000 with follow-up to 2014 (up to 17 yr).
